Snowflake is looking for a Partner Marketing Intern to support the EMEA partner marketing team in generating leads and executing regional campaigns. The role emphasizes marketing operations and cross-functional collaboration, with a focus on multi-channel initiatives and automation tools.

Location: Must be based in or able to travel to the London or Amsterdam office. The internship requires a year-long placement and offers mentorship, with potential for post-internship career advancement.
